In some cases, services to be provided to clients may need to be opened and/or used through a contract/protocol. In such cases, it may be necessary to keep the contract/protocol text with its history and know which services and credentials are associated with this contract/protocol.
When the Contracts/Protocols page is first entered, all existing contract/protocol records are listed as shown in the image below: Contracts/Protocols List To create a new contract/protocol, press the Create button in the upper right corner and complete the contract/protocol record by saving the information shown in the image below. Or to create a new contract/protocol based on settings from an existing contract/protocol, click the Add a Contract option from the detail menu of the record. Credentials Tab

If it is desired for credentials related to the contract/protocol to be included within the contract/protocol record, press the Add button marked in red in the image below. Credentials Tab When the Add button is pressed, the credential list within the project or defined globally is listed as shown in the image below. Adding Credential List Credentials for which a relationship with the contract is desired to be established are selected from this list and saved. If the desired credential is not in this list, a new credential can be created by pressing the Create button.
